Beckhoff EL5042 EtherCAT Encoder Terminal

The Beckhoff EL5042 is an EtherCAT terminal with a two-channel encoder interface supporting BiSS-C (unidirectional) and SSI (Synchronous Serial Interface) protocols. This module enables direct connection of absolute encoders with BiSS-C or SSI interfaces, including both singleturn and multiturn encoders, to an EtherCAT network. The EL5042 acts as a BiSS-C master, transmitting clock signals to the encoder and receiving data over a serial interface. It is ideal for high-precision position feedback in motion control, robotics, and positioning applications.

Technical Specifications

The EL5042 features two independent encoder channels. Encoder operating voltage: external 5 V (supplied via optional ZK1090 cable) or 9 V (generated from the power contacts). The total current for both encoders is 0.5 A. The terminal supports unidirectional BiSS-C protocol (data transmission triggered by master clock) and SSI protocol (compatible with standard SSI encoders). Data transmission is clocked by the EtherCAT master. The terminal is designed to work with encoders from various manufacturers. Key specifications include: E-bus current consumption typical: 250 mA (depending on encoder load). The module is compliant with the CANopen over EtherCAT (CoE) protocol. The EL5042 is designed for use with Beckhoff EK1100 or EK1501 EtherCAT couplers. Operating temperature range: 0°C to 55°C. Storage temperature: -25°C to 85°C. Protection rating: IP20. Dimensions: 12 mm (W) × 100 mm (H) × 68 mm (D). The terminal mounts on a 35 mm DIN rail.

BiSS-C and SSI Protocol Support

The EL5042 supports the unidirectional BiSS-C protocol, which is a high-speed serial interface commonly used with absolute encoders for motion control. Data transmission is triggered by the master clock (generated by the EL5042). The end of data transmission is identified with a timeout. This protocol allows the reading of singleturn position (position within one revolution), multiturn position (number of revolutions), and encoder status/error bits. The module also supports the widely used SSI protocol, enabling connection of legacy SSI encoders. The EL5042 can be configured via CoE objects to match the encoder's data format (number of data bits, code type, baud rate). Supported baud rates are determined by the encoder requirements and the EtherCAT cycle time.

EtherCAT Integration

The EL5042 communicates with the Beckhoff EtherCAT system via the E-bus interface. It supports distributed clocks for precise synchronization of position data with the EtherCAT cycle. Configuration is performed in TwinCAT engineering environment, which automatically detects the terminal and assigns process data objects. The user selects the encoder type (SSI or BiSS-C) and configures the data format (e.g., 25-bit singleturn + 12-bit multiturn). The EL5042 then reads the position value and presents it as a 32-bit integer value in the process image. Diagnostic information (encoder error, data validity) is also available. The module supports both position and velocity data from encoders that provide velocity information.


Applications

The EL5042 is used in applications requiring precise absolute position feedback, including machine tools (spindle and feed axes), robotic systems (joint angle feedback), linear and rotary positioning stages, packaging machinery (cut-to-length registration), and printing presses (paper tension control). The SSI support allows connection of cost-effective SSI encoders, while BiSS-C support provides high-speed, high-resolution feedback for advanced motion control applications. The two-channel configuration allows a single terminal to serve two axes, reducing hardware cost and panel space.

Installation and Wiring

Install the EL5042 in an EtherCAT terminal strand by attaching it to the right side of an EtherCAT coupler (e.g., EK1100) or to an existing terminal. Use the double slot and key connection system for side-by-side mounting. Connect the BiSS-C or SSI encoder to the terminals using Beckhoff ZK1090 series cables (ZK1090-9191-xxxx or similar) or custom wiring. Pinout for the encoder connection: Data+, Data-, Clock+, Clock- (for BiSS-C and differential SSI). For single-ended SSI signals, appropriate wiring adaptations may be required. The EL5042 provides encoder power on the terminals (5 V or 9 V). The terminal automatically detects the presence of encoders and signals any wiring errors via the status LEDs. The module must be installed in a control cabinet with adequate clearance for heat dissipation.

Configuration and Diagnostics

Configuration of the EL5042 is performed via CoE (CANopen over EtherCAT) objects in TwinCAT. Key parameters include: encoder protocol (BiSS-C or SSI), data length (bits), position format (Gray code or binary), baud rate, sampling rate, and encoder supply voltage selection. The module provides diagnostic information including wire break detection, invalid data detection, and encoder communication errors. Status LEDs: green (run) for power and E-bus communication, and per-channel LEDs for encoder activity and errors. The TwinCAT System Manager displays real-time position data and diagnostic information for each channel.


Product Comparison

Beckhoff offers several encoder interface terminals. The EL5042 supports BiSS-C (unidirectional) and SSI, whereas EL5001 and EL5002 support SSI only. The EL5001 has one channel, while the EL5002 has two channels (SSI only). The EL5042 is the only 2-channel terminal that supports BiSS-C unidirectional. For BiSS-C bidirectional communication (with data feedback), other terminals are required. The encoder operating voltage for the EL5042 is 5 V or 9 V, whereas some other terminals provide 24 V encoder supply directly from the power contacts.

Environmental and Compliance

The EL5042 is CE and UL certified. It is RoHS compliant. Operating temperature: 0°C to 55°C. Storage temperature: -25°C to 85°C. Humidity: 5-95% non-condensing. Vibration resistance: 2g (10-55 Hz). Protection rating: IP20. The terminal must be installed in a control cabinet.
